Ways to avoid eating out
With proper planning and foresight one can avoid the hazards of eating out.
How to Plan
Plan your day in such a way that eating out is minimized
- Start the day with a hearty breakfast. This is the meal we tend to skip.
- Plan your day. There is no reason why with proper planning you cannot cut down on eating out. Keep your appointments away from meal times. Let it be a midmorning appointment or a late afternoon one rather than discussion over a business meal or dinner. Even if you have to, make sure it is a restaurant where you will be able to get a healthy meal.
- Make sure you always have some healthy food at hand so that you are not tempted to eat out. Always keep some fruit like apples or peaches which are easy to eat. Some baby carrots, cucumbers or small radishes would also do. Even a tossed salad can be carried or popcorns or a zero fat snack. You can even try carrying a light sandwich so that if the need arises you can have a light, easy and healthy lunch.
- Always stock your home with 'quick to cook' meals you like. Make at least two visits to the market in a week to prevent yourself from going out to forage for food or having an excuse to eat out. Make sure that the fridge is full of healthy food and the dry ingredients are also in stock. Don't give yourself the excuse to eat out
- Never be hungry. Eat at regular intervals. Don't let the hunger pangs attack you. Hunger makes you prone to eating indiscriminately. Stick to your timings and learn to recognize the hunger signals. Eat before it becomes unbearable.
What to Stock
- Shop at least twice a week. Go and buy the fresh vegetables, fruits and your favorite salads. Stock the fridge with paneer, sauces and yoghurt of your choice. Try and pick food which you enjoy and which needs minimum cooking. Make sure all dry ingredients are also stocked.
- Prepare some dishes and stock. Healthy fruits salads, salad dressings and sandwich spreads can always be prepared in advance or over the weekend. Plenty of vegetables should be chopped and cut and ready to cook.
- Frozen foods can be stocked for emergency days
How to Eat Out if you Have to
First of all avoid eating out but this is not always possible. There are times when one can't avoid eating out. Business lunches, coffee with friends, weekend celebrations are all a part of life. The solution is to learn how to face them. Learn to eat healthy when you are out. One has to learn to minimize the hazards of eating out
- Take a light snack or a helping of fruit before you go out. Do not go out on an empty stomach. A gnawing hunger encourages bingeing and over eating.
- Start with a salad of your choice. It should be a salad with a non creamy base or a low fat dressing. Choose a low yoghurt dressing which is healthy and light. Make it a light vinegar dressing if possible. Avoid mayonnaise and cream.
- You can always ask for amendments to a dish. It can be ordered without cream or dollops of butter. It can be modified to your taste and requirements.
- Wherever possible order stir fried vegetables instead of fried or cream based ones.
- Whenever possible have whole wheat products instead of refined flour. Have chapattis instead of naans and kulchas
Sticking to these habits is difficult to start with, but you get addicted to these once you begin practicing…yes, good eating habits can be addictive too! Try it!
